Learner-Led Athletics

At The Forest School, sports aren’t just about competition—they’re about learning to live and grow together. Our learners themselves launched our athletics program, starting girls’ volleyball and boys’ basketball, and they continue to shape it. Here, any learner can found a new team by rallying enough teammates and partnering with a parent-volunteer coach.


Proud Members of GAPPS

We are proud members of the Georgia Association of Private and Parochial Schools (GAPPS), giving our athletes the chance to compete with other schools across the state.

Today, our teams include:

    •    Girls’ Middle School and Varsity Volleyball

    •    Boys’ Middle School and High School Basketball
